SUMMARY: We are seeking a motivated student worker to provide administrative support for our Headwind Scholars Program and Support Office. Mark Orphan (Program Director) and Laura Weber (program Coordinator) will provide supervision and support to this role. Our program currently serves 9 undergrad students enrolled at Vanguard. We are seeking a candidate that can start by November 3 2025 and work through May 7 2026. Student worker MUST be a graduate student.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S: - Scheduling meetings for Headwind Scholars Program Director and Program Coordinator by request.
- Managing event details
- Group and individual email and text communications with scholarship students
- Tracking project timelines for Headwind Scholars Program Director and Program Coordinator.
- Occasional printing and mailing projects.
- Writing thank you notes to supporters and volunteers.
- Other tasks assigned by Headwind Scholars Program Director and Program Coordinator.
REQUIRED DATES: - November 4 Program Vision Lunch Event
- May 7 Commencement
THE IDEAL CANDIDATE: - Current graduate student enrolled at Vanguard University in good standing.
- Vibrant belief in Jesus Christ with ample evidence of personal discipleship.
- Maintain minimum grade point average of 2.0 each term.
- Demonstrated commitment as a team player to support and collaborate with faculty staff peers and external constituents as well as the initiative and ability to work independently.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ills that will result in effective collaboration.
COMPENSATION: This position is 6 - 10 hours per week at a rate of $19 per hour. Headwind Scholars is a grant serving students formerly in foster care. |
